数控机床用什么编程软件
-
数控机床常用的编程软件有多种,下面将介绍几种常见的编程软件。
-
G代码编程软件:G代码是数控机床最常用的一种编程语言。G代码编程软件可以帮助用户编写G代码程序,通过输入不同的指令和参数来控制机床的运动轨迹、速度、刀具切削深度等。常见的G代码编程软件有AutoCAD、Mastercam、PowerMill等。
-
CAM软件:CAM(计算机辅助制造)软件可以将设计好的零件模型自动转换为机床可识别的G代码程序。CAM软件可以根据用户设定的加工参数自动生成最优的刀具路径,并对加工过程进行模拟和优化。常见的CAM软件有Pro/ENGINEER、SolidWorks、UG等。
-
虚拟仿真软件:虚拟仿真软件可以帮助用户在计算机上模拟机床加工过程,实现虚拟加工。用户可以在虚拟环境中进行刀具路径规划、碰撞检测、加工参数优化等操作,以提高加工效率和质量。常见的虚拟仿真软件有VERICUT、NCSIMUL等。
-
编辑器软件:编辑器软件主要用于编辑和修改G代码程序。用户可以在编辑器中对G代码进行手动输入、调整和修正,以满足不同加工需求。常见的编辑器软件有Notepad++、UltraEdit等。
总而言之,数控机床的编程软件种类繁多,选择适合自己的编程软件可以提高编程效率和加工质量。根据自己的需要和机床类型,选择合适的编程软件将会对数控机床的加工效果产生积极的影响。
1年前 -
-
数控机床一般使用专门的编程软件进行程序编写。这些编程软件通常被称为数控编程软件或CAM软件。下面是几种常用的数控机床编程软件:
-
Mastercam:Mastercam是一款功能强大且广泛使用的数控编程软件。它支持多种数控机床,包括铣床、车床、线切割机床等。Mastercam提供直观的用户界面和丰富的工具,使用户能够快速、准确地创建数控程序。
-
Siemens NX:Siemens NX是一款综合性的数控编程软件,支持多种数控机床和加工操作。它提供了强大的建模和仿真功能,可以帮助用户进行复杂的加工过程规划和优化。
-
SolidWorks CAM:SolidWorks CAM是SolidWorks CAD软件的一个模块,用于数控编程。它与SolidWorks CAD软件集成紧密,可以直接从CAD模型中生成数控程序,提高编程的效率和准确性。
-
AutoCAD CAM:AutoCAD CAM是AutoCAD CAD软件的一个模块,用于数控编程。它提供了丰富的工具和功能,可以快速生成高质量的数控程序。
-
Fusion 360:Fusion 360是一款综合性的CAD/CAM软件,支持多种数控机床和加工操作。它具有直观的用户界面和强大的建模和仿真功能,可以帮助用户进行全面的数控编程。
这些编程软件都具有不同的特点和功能,选择适合自己的数控编程软件需要考虑机床类型、加工需求、个人经验等因素。此外,还应注意软件的兼容性和用户界面的友好性,以提高编程的效率和准确性。
1年前 -
-
数控机床的编程软件主要有以下几种:
-
G代码编程软件:G代码是数控机床最基本的控制语言,通过编写G代码来控制机床的运动。G代码编程软件通常提供了图形界面和文本界面两种方式,用户可以根据自己的需求选择合适的方式进行编程。常用的G代码编程软件有Mastercam、PowerMILL等。
-
CAD/CAM软件:CAD(计算机辅助设计)软件用于设计产品的三维模型,CAM(计算机辅助制造)软件则将设计好的模型转化为数控机床可以识别的G代码。CAD/CAM软件通常具有强大的模型编辑、加工路径规划和后处理功能,可以提高编程效率和加工精度。常用的CAD/CAM软件有AutoCAD、SolidWorks、Pro/ENGINEER等。
-
前处理软件:前处理软件用于将CAD模型转化为机床可识别的G代码。它可以对CAD模型进行分析、修正和优化,生成合适的刀具路径和切削参数,并生成相应的G代码。常用的前处理软件有CATIA、UG、Pro/ENGINEER等。
-
模拟仿真软件:模拟仿真软件可以在计算机上对数控机床进行模拟运行,以验证程序的正确性和可行性。它可以模拟机床的运动、刀具的切削过程和材料的加工情况,帮助用户发现并解决潜在的问题。常用的模拟仿真软件有VERICUT、NCSIMUL等。
-
后处理软件:后处理软件用于将CAM软件生成的G代码转化为特定数控机床的控制代码。不同的机床控制系统有不同的代码格式和语法要求,后处理软件可以根据用户选择的机床类型和控制系统生成相应的控制代码。常用的后处理软件有PostWorks、GibbsCAM等。
总结起来,数控机床的编程软件包括G代码编程软件、CAD/CAM软件、前处理软件、模拟仿真软件和后处理软件。用户可以根据自己的需求选择合适的软件进行编程,以提高编程效率和加工精度。
1年前 -